On Tuesday 08 July 2003 14:16, Troels Arvin wrote:
> My system: Red Hat 9. wxGTK from
> http://shrike.freshrpms.net/rpm.html?id=644

Do not use these RPMs from http://shrike.freshrpms.net, because they are
linked against GTK+, not GTK2+. We provide ready to use wxGTK RPMs at:

http://www.pgadmin.org/snapshots/linux/.../wxGTK
